Blocco di flusso in Amazon Connect: richiama una funzione AWS Lambda - Amazon Connect

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

Blocco di flusso in Amazon Connect: richiama una funzione AWS Lambda

Questo argomento definisce il blocco di flusso per la chiamata AWS Lambda alla restituzione di coppie chiave-valore che è possibile utilizzare per impostare gli attributi dei contatti.

Descrizione

Canali supportati

La tabella seguente elenca il modo in cui questo blocco instrada un contatto che utilizza il canale specificato.

Canale Supportato?

Voce

Chat

Attività

Tipi di flusso

È possibile utilizzare questo blocco nei seguenti tipi di flusso:

  • Flusso in entrata

  • Flusso di coda del cliente

  • Flusso di attesa del cliente

  • Flusso di messaggi vocali del cliente

  • Flusso di attesa dell'agente

  • Flusso di messaggi vocali dell'agente

  • Flusso di trasferimento all'agente

  • Flusso di trasferimento alla coda

Proprietà

L'immagine seguente mostra la pagina delle proprietà del blocco Richiama funzione AWS Lambda .

La pagina delle proprietà del blocco funzionale AWS Lambda Invoke.

Nota le seguenti proprietà:

  • Timeout: immetti il tempo di attesa per il timeout di Lambda.

    Se la tua invocazione Lambda è oggetto di limitazione, la richiesta verrà ripresentata. Viene ripetuta anche se si verifica un errore di servizio generale (errore 500).

    Quando una chiamata sincrona restituisce un errore, Amazon Connect riprova fino a tre volte, per un massimo di 8 secondi. Dopodiché, il contatto viene instradato al ramo Error (Errore).

  • Convalida della risposta: la risposta della funzione Lambda può essere STRING un MAP _ JSON o e deve essere impostata durante la configurazione del blocco di funzione Invoke AWS Lambda nel flusso. Se la convalida della risposta è impostata su STRING _MAP, la funzione lambda dovrebbe restituire un oggetto flat composto da coppie chiave/valore del tipo stringa. Altrimenti, se la convalida della risposta è impostata su, la funzione lambda può restituire qualsiasi valore validoJSON, incluso quello annidato. JSON JSON

Consigli per la configurazione

  • Per utilizzare una AWS Lambda funzione in un flusso, aggiungi prima la funzione all'istanza. Per ulteriori informazioni, consultaAggiunta di una funzione Lambda all'istanza Amazon Connect,

  • Dopo aver aggiunto la funzione per l'istanza, puoi selezionare la funzione dall'elenco a discesa Seleziona una funzione nel blocco da usare nel flusso.

Blocco configurato

L'immagine seguente mostra un esempio dell'aspetto del blocco quando viene configurato. Presenta due rami: Successo ed Errore.

Un blocco di AWS Lambda funzioni Invoke configurato.

Flussi di esempio

Amazon Connect include una serie di flussi di esempio. Per istruzioni che spiegano come accedere ai flussi di esempio nel designer del flusso, consulta Flussi di esempio in Amazon Connect. Di seguito sono riportati gli argomenti che descrivono i flussi di esempio che includono questo blocco.

Esempio di flusso di integrazione Lambda in Amazon Connect

Scenari

Vedi questi argomenti per gli scenari che utilizzano questo blocco: